Western Felixstowe is a residential area located in the coastal town of Felixstowe, within East Suffolk. The ward is primarily made up of suburban housing, with a mix of detached, semi-detached, and terraced homes. It is situated inland from the seafront, offering a quieter atmosphere compared to the more tourist-heavy eastern parts of the town. Local amenities include shops, schools, and parks, catering to families and long-term residents.
The area is well-connected by road, with easy access to the A14, linking it to Ipswich and beyond. Public transport options include bus services running through the ward. Western Felixstowe also features green spaces like the King George V playing fields, providing recreational opportunities. The ward has a strong community presence, with local events and groups fostering connections among residents.
On average Western Felixstowe has high de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 58 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 23.4%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Western Felixstowe is £40,202 per year. There are 3 schools in Western Felixstowe: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good).
